2011-09-30 5 views
2

사용자 이름과 암호를 기반으로 일부 데이터를 얻는 응용 프로그램을 만들어야합니다.HTML5 로컬 저장소는 어떻게 작동합니까?

웹 사이트의 여러 HTML 페이지에 대해 단일 영구 로컬 저장소를 만들 수 있습니까? 페이지가로드 될 때마다 레코드를 삽입해야합니까? 내 기대는 레코드를 여러 번 삽입하는 것입니다. 누구든지 도와 줄 수 있습니까?

+1

위로 올라 가기 : http://diveintohtml5.org/storage.html –

답변

5

예, 저장 용량은 도메인 수준이므로 페이지로드시 데이터를 '새로 고침'하거나 다시 채울 필요가 없습니다. 또한 세션에서도 살아남을 수 있지만 모든 것이 키/값 쌍인 이 문자열으로 저장되어 있으므로 다시 읽으려고 할 때 구문 분석해야합니다 (JSON.parse());

+0

어떻게하면 html5에 데이터베이스와 같은 도메인 수준의 저장소를 만들 수 있습니까? HTML5 페이지에 모든 기밀 레코드를 수동으로 추가해야하므로 어떻게 하나만 호출 할 수 있습니까? 시각? viewource 코드를 통해 브라우저의 사용자가 본 레코드가 있습니까? 알았어? – youCanCheatMe

+1

예, Chrome 개발자 도구를 사용하는 경우 리소스 패널에 '로컬 저장소'옵션이 있습니다. 그것을 선택하면 컴퓨터에 로컬로 저장된 모든 정보를 볼 수 있습니다. 나는 당신이 데이터를 난독 화하고 싶지만 데이터를 변조하거나 삭제하는 것을 멈추게 할 방법이 없다면 자신의 암호화/복호화를 사용할 수 있다고 생각한다. 그것은 결국 자신의 PC에 있습니다. – LDJ

관련 문제